The Toronto Maple Leafs will face elimination against the Florida Panthers Wednesday night at FLA Live Arena without starting goaltender Ilya Samsonov. As confirmed by coach Sheldon Keefe Tuesday following practice, Samsonov isn’t available for Game 4 due to an upper-body injury.
Ilya Samsonov is day to day with an upper-body injury. Sheldon Keefe did not consider giving Game 4’s start to Matt Murray.He was injured early in the second period of Sunday’s Game 3 when his teammate, defenseman Luke Schenn, crashed into him while jockeying for position with Panthers forward Carter Verhaeghe. Samsonov took several minutes to get up and left the game, which the Leafs were winning 1-0 at the time, and was replaced by rookie Joseph Woll.
Keefe has named Woll the starter for Game 4 and indicated there was no consideration to starting the now-healthy Matt Murray, who hasn’t seen game action since suffering a head injury in early April. Woll stopped 18 of 21 shots in Game 3 for a pedestrian .
Woll, 24, is the Leafs’ top netminding prospect. He delivered an All-Star season with the AHL’s Toronto Marlies and excelled at the NHL level late in 2022-23, posting a 6-1-0 record and .932 save percentage.
